Blackwood makes 25 saves as OHL blanks Russia

Spencer Watson scored twice and Dylan Strome added another as the OHL shutout Russia in the Canada Russia Series.

OWEN SOUND, Ont. — Spencer Watson had a pair of goals as a team of Ontario Hockey League all-stars downed Russia 3-0 on Thursday in the third of a six-game exhibition series hosted by the Canadian Hockey League.

Dylan Strome added a goal and an assist for Team OHL (3-0-0), while Mackenzie Blackwood stopped 25 shots to earn the shutout.

Maxim Tretiak turned aside 35 shots for Russia (0-3-0), which dropped the first two games of the series to the Western Hockey League all-stars on the West Coast.

Team OHL went 1 for 5 on the power play while Russia failed to score on five chances with the man advantage.

Game 4 will feature Team OHL against Russia on Monday in Windsor, Ont. The final two games will see Russia take on the top players from the Quebec Major Junior Hockey League.<
